site stats

Gpu oversubscription

WebAug 20, 2024 · For oversubscription, the authors claim that in general a random eviction algorithm performs very well to more complex strategies, considering overheads of the latter. In paper , the authors introduce GPUswap allowing relocation of application data from the GPU to system RAM allowing oversubscription of memory. At the time of the … WebOct 29, 2024 · A pascal or volta GPU running in linux OS can have its memory “oversubscribed”. In that case, the GPU runtime will swap pages of memory as needed …

An Economy-Oriented GPU Virtualization with Dynamic and …

WebSep 19, 2024 · The --oversubscribe and --exclusive options are mutually exclusive when used at job submission. If both options are set when submitting a job, the job submission command used will fatal. Examples of CR_Memory, CR_Socket_Memory, and CR_CPU_Memory type consumable resources WebJun 9, 2024 · Whenever you overclock a component of your PC, whether that be the CPU, GPU, or RAM, it shortens its lifespan. As long as your GPU will last until you upgrade to … can i notarize a document in bank of america https://lutzlandsurveying.com

Time-Slicing GPUs in Kubernetes — NVIDIA Cloud Native …

WebAug 29, 2016 · In OpenGL or DirectX 11, the driver traditionally has been supporting the application’s resource allocation by moving resources between device local and system memory in case of oversubscription … WebMar 14, 2015 · In this paper, we present GPUswap, a novel approach to enabling oversubscription of GPU memory that does not rely on software scheduling of GPU … WebPerformance overhead under memory oversubscription comes from the thrashing of memory pages over slow CPU-GPU interconnect. Depending on the diverse computing and memory access pattern, each application demands special … five dark fates summary

Improving Oversubscribed GPU Memory Performance in …

Category:A quantitative evaluation of unified memory in GPUs

Tags:Gpu oversubscription

Gpu oversubscription

Enabling GPU Memory Oversubscription via Transparent Paging …

WebMay 1, 2024 · Yu et al. [42] proposed a coordinated page prefetch and eviction design to manage oversubscription for GPUs with unified memory. NVIDIA developers [43] explored different designs to improve GPU ... WebJun 30, 2024 · These designs involve optimizations for GPU memory allocation, CPU/GPU memory movement, and GPU memory oversubscription, respectively. More specifically, first, MemHC employs duplication-aware management and lazy release of GPU memories to corresponding host managing for better data reusability.

Gpu oversubscription

Did you know?

WebApr 6, 2024 · This paper proposes a novel intelligent framework for oversubscription management in CPU-GPU UVM. We analyze the current rule-based methods of GPU memory oversubscription with unified memory, and the current learning-based methods for other computer architectural components. We then identify the performance gap … Weboversubscription comes from the thrashing of memory pages over slow CPU-GPU interconnect. Depending on the diverse computing and memory access pattern, each …

WebNov 20, 2024 · The GPU can generate many faults concurrently and it’s possible to get multiple fault messages for the same page. The Unified Memory driver processes these faults, remove duplicates, updates … WebeachelementinA_gpu,B_gpuandC_gpuisaccessedonce,theor- der of accessing is different, which leads to differentpage fault numbers.For and ,theelementsareaccessedrow-wise,but is

WebMar 16, 2016 · Without modifying the GPU execution pipeline, we show it is possible to largely hide the performance overheads of GPU paged memory, converting an average 2× slowdown into a 12% speedup when compared to programmer directed transfers. Additionally, we examine the performance impact that GPU memory oversubscription … WebOversubscribing GPU Unified Virtual Memory: Implications and Suggestions Computer systems organization Architectures Parallel architectures Single instruction, multiple data Hardware Communication hardware, interfaces and storage External storage View Table of …

WebThe NVIDIA GPU Operator allows oversubscription of GPUs through a set of extended options for the NVIDIA Kubernetes Device Plugin . Internally, GPU time-slicing is used to …

WebSpecifically, a GPU paging implementation is proposed as an extension to NVIDIA's embedded Linux GPU drivers. In experiments reported herein, this implementation was … five dark side of modern scienceWebGraphics card oversubscription •NVIDIA concept •Based on scheduler chosen •For the T4 card, light user could get more than 12.5% of GPU resources •Fixed at GPU frame buffer divided by vGPU profile •For an NVIDIA P4 card •For a 2Q profile: 8GB frame buffer/2GB frame buffer per user = 4 Users per card. User count per graphics card can i notarize a warranty deedWebNov 11, 2024 · Popular deep learning frameworks like PyTorch utilize GPUs heavily for training, and suffer from out-of-memory (OOM) problems if memory is not managed properly. CUDA Unified Memory (UM) allows the oversubscription of tensor objects in the GPU, but suffers from heavy performance penalties. can i notarize a family members documentWeboversubscription of GPU DRAM [22]–[26] has focused on paging GPU memory to CPU memory—an intractable ap-proach on embedded systems where CPU and GPU share … can i notarize a will in californiaWebApr 6, 2024 · This paper proposes a novel intelligent framework for oversubscription management in CPU-GPU UVM. We analyze the current rule-based methods of GPU … can i notarize a power of attorneyWebApr 1, 2024 · Recent support for unified memory and demand paging has improved GPU programmability and enabled memory oversubscription. However, this support introduces high overhead when page faults occur. can i notarize a document without the personWebNov 11, 2024 · Adv(CPU) is an experimental case where we place tensors on host memory to be directly accessed by GPU in order to avoid page faults and transfers to GPU … can i notarize a will in ny